William: Can you give us a few quick tips on basic things everyone can do to start getting healthy right now? Christina: Four easy things everyone can start doing today: 1. Drink more water. You should drink a minimum of 1/2 your body weight in water every day. 2. Get good sleep. Your body needs at least seven hours of sleep a night. 3. Move every joint in every direction every day. The body wants to move. We tend to move in the same ways every day. It’s important to move in diverse ways, regularly. 4. Reduce your intake of common dietary causes of inflammation: a. Dairy b. Caffeine c. Alcohol d. Refined sugar e. Soy f. Wheat William: What’s your advice for young women interested in your field? Christina: The patient must be the priority. The number one frustration I hear from clients, they don’t feel heard from their physicians. The therapeutic relationship does just as much, maybe more, than any intervention. When the patient or client feels heard, safe, attended to, cared for, that’s when the healing happens. The most important thing any new therapist can do is learn how to create an effective therapeutic container. If you aren’t sure if holistic or integrative health is right for you, intern somewhere, get some experience, see if it’s right for you, if it speaks to you. You only have your imagination until you’ve done the work.
